Output 595ca61d4eb5599d9943367f56b461874c107e54a5a7e463f114de1f89b15e2d:0

value
226030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43eab7c7ff9db5868798b66fe3c344609fdce2f0 OP_EQUAL
address
37t8Nt6DTGHdkRBvuv2EWnACUgY4yX8EPi
transaction
595ca61d4eb5599d9943367f56b461874c107e54a5a7e463f114de1f89b15e2d
spent
true